Weather Overview in Adelaide
Adelaide's weather features a Mediterranean pattern with hot, dry summers and cool, wet winters. Average annual temperature is 63°F (17°C), with 70°F (21°C) highs and 54°F (12°C) lows. Summers (December-February) see highs of 82-86°F (28-30°C) and minimal rain (about 1 inch/25 mm per month). Winters (June-August) bring 59-61°F (15-16°C) highs, 46-48°F (8-9°C) lows, and peak rainfall of 3 inches (75 mm) monthly. Spring and autumn offer transitional mild conditions ideal for outdoor events at Eynesbury College. Extremes include heatwaves reaching 116°F (47°C) and rare frosts to 30°F (-1°C). Environmental Factors in Adelaide
Adelaide sits at low altitude (30m/100ft) on sedimentary plains with no active volcanoes. Geology features stable hills, minimizing seismic risks. Air quality excels with AQI 20-40 yearly, supporting health for Eynesbury College community. Low pollution density from coastal breezes reduces respiratory issues.
